Definition of GAP

Broadly, a GAP approach aims at applying available knowledge to

addressing environmental, economic and social sustainability

dimensions for on-farm production and post-production processes,

resulting in safe and quality food and non-food agricultural products

+ The ASEAN Good Agricultural Practices (GAP) Project

Title Quality Assurance Systems for ASEAN Fruit (QASAF) Project (2004) – KICK OFF PROJECT Implemented during Phase III of the ASEAN-Australia Economic Cooperation Program (AAECP)

Outcome 1. Good Agricultural Practices (GAP) standard for the production of fresh fruit and vegetables in the ASEAN region 2. Establishment of ASEAN GAP Task Force to provide guidance in the final stages of the drafting of the GAP standard and implementation guidelines

The Philippine GAP Program

…Due to Philippine participation in the AADCP project stream which aimed to develop a harmonized ASEAN GAP, the Philippines conceptualized and developed its own National GAP program

PHILGAP – GOVERNMENT CERTIFICATION PROGRAM

Thus, is fully subsidized by the government NO APPLICATION FEE NO INSPECTION OR CERTIFICATION FEES NO RENEWAL FEES

PHILGAP PROGRAM

DA as the certification body and NOT BAFPS DA SECRETARY signs the certificate and NOT BAFPS Director

BAFPS – program secretariat BAFPS provides the funds for the program (analyses, cost of inspection, per diem and travelling expenses of inspectors

NO MINIMUM AREA REQUIREMENT

There is no provision in the Administrative Order that limits application for certification based on AREA, or MINIMUM INCOME

Inspection

Important Note: Assessment of the farm will be against the minimum requirements set in the four (4) modules of the standard: food safety; produce quality; workers, health, safety and welfare; and environmental management.
